Stedin Group issues new €500 million green bond

Rotterdam, 23 October 2025 – Stedin Group has successfully issued a new €500 million green bond. The proceeds will be invested in the expansion and reinforcement of the electricity grid to facilitate the energy transition. Since 2019, green bonds have been the primary source of financing for the grid operator. To date, Stedin Group has issued a total of €3 billion in green bonds.

The €500 million bond has a maturity of 7 years, an issue price of 99.491%, and a coupon rate of 3.00% (yielding an effective interest rate of 3.082%). With this issuance, Stedin Group has attracted both existing and new sustainable investors. The bond was nearly four times oversubscribed, contributing to the favorable terms under which it was issued. The bond is listed on Euronext Amsterdam under ISIN code XS3218684101.

Annual Investment Growth

This year, Stedin is investing a record amount of approximately €1.3 billion in its gas and electricity networks. This figure will continue to grow over the next few years. These investments are essential not only to enable the energy transition but also to support the expanding economy and housing development. At the same time, maintenance is carried out to ensure the networks remain reliable and safe.

CFO Jaap Verhoeff: "With the issuance of this green bond, we are taking an important step toward enabling the energy transition. The investments we make in a future-proof grid are financed through both revenues and new debt issuances, such as this green bond. We are pleased with the strong interest investors have shown in our company. The proceeds will be used to further expand the electricity grid in line with the growing demand for sustainable energy."

Green Finance Framework

The proceeds from this green bond will be allocated to a broad range of sustainable projects, including the connection of new solar parks to the electricity grid and enabling the decarbonization of businesses and residential properties. These initiatives empower our customers to reduce their own CO₂ emissions—an essential pillar of Stedin’s Environmental, Social, and Governance (ESG) strategy. The issuance of this green bond is based on the updated Green Finance Framework published in September 2025.

About Stedin Group 

Working together towards a world full of new energy. This is the goal that the approximately 7,000 employees of Stedin Group are striving to achieve every day. We believe that it is our responsibility to ensure that all our customers have access to the sustainable energy they need to live, work and conduct business. Stedin Group is increasing the sustainability and maintaining the robustness and affordability of the energy system. This is achieved through the combined efforts of grid operator Stedin (active in the greater part of the provinces of Zuid-Holland, Utrecht and Zeeland) and the experts of NetVerder and infrastructure company DNWG Infra, all three of which are part of Stedin Group.
